编程后为什么不能用
-
编程后不能用的原因可能有以下几个方面:
-
代码错误:在编写程序时,可能会出现语法错误、逻辑错误或者其他的编程错误。这些错误会导致程序无法正常运行或者产生错误的结果。在程序中未经过充分测试的情况下发布,可能会导致程序无法正常工作。
-
环境问题:编程语言经常会依赖于特定的开发环境或者运行时环境。如果将程序放置在没有相应环境的机器上运行,可能会导致程序无法正常工作。例如,如果你使用的是Java开发的程序,那么在没有安装Java运行环境的机器上,这个程序就不能正常运行。
-
兼容性问题:不同的操作系统、硬件平台和软件版本可能会有不同的特性和规范。在考虑到这些因素之前,开发的程序可能无法与特定平台或者系统版本兼容,从而无法正常运行。
-
资源限制:有时候程序可能需要大量的计算资源、内存或者存储空间才能正常工作。如果程序运行的机器上资源有限,那么程序可能无法正常运行。
-
外部条件影响:编程后的程序可能受到外部条件的影响,比如网络连接、设备故障等。如果这些外部条件无法满足,程序可能无法正常工作。
总之,在编程后不能用的情况下,需要对程序进行仔细的调试和测试,查找错误并修复它们。同时,也要确保程序运行的环境和条件满足程序的要求。只有在经过充分测试和验证之后,才能确保程序能够正常工作。
1年前 -
-
以下是编程结束后不能再使用的一些原因:
-
编程疲劳:编程是一项需要高度集中精力和思考的任务。长时间进行编程工作会导致身心疲劳和失去兴趣,从而难以保持高效的工作状态。疲劳和失去兴趣可能会导致错误的产生,代码的质量和性能可能会下降。
-
程序错误和漏洞:即使经过仔细的测试和调试,编程完成后的程序仍然可能存在错误和漏洞。这些错误和漏洞可能会导致程序崩溃、数据丢失或安全漏洞。因此,即使编程完成,同样需要进行持续的测试和维护来修复错误和漏洞。
-
需求变更:所开发的程序往往是为了解决特定的问题或满足特定的需求。然而,随着时间的推移,需求可能会发生变化。如果不及时地更新和维护程序以适应新的需求,程序可能会变得过时且无法满足用户的期望。因此,即使编程完成,还需要对程序进行维护和更新,以确保其与用户需求的一致性。
-
技术革新:编程世界发展迅速,每天都有新的编程语言、框架和工具被引入。如果停止学习和跟进这些新技术的进展,程序员可能会逐渐失去竞争力。因此,即使编程完成,仍需要不断学习和保持更新,以跟上技术革新的步伐。
-
项目维护和支持:一旦程序被部署和使用,用户可能会遇到问题或需要技术支持。程序员需要继续提供维护和支持,以确保程序能够正常运行和满足用户的需求。这可能包括修复错误、更新程序、提供用户培训等等。
总之,编程是一个需要持续投入和不断更新的过程。一旦编程完成,并不能意味着工作结束,而是需要进行测试、维护和更新,以确保程序的质量和性能,并满足不断变化的用户需求。
1年前 -
-
编程后不能用的原因有很多,以下是一些可能的原因:
-
编译错误:编程语言中的代码需要经过编译器的处理才能运行。如果代码中存在语法错误,编译器无法正确解析代码,编译过程会出现错误。编译错误通常会给出错误的位置和具体的错误信息,开发者需要修复这些错误才能使代码可用。
-
运行时错误:运行时错误是在代码运行过程中发生的错误。这些错误可能是由于逻辑错误、数据类型不匹配、空指针引用等问题导致的。当运行时错误发生时,程序可能会崩溃或产生异常,导致程序无法继续运行。
-
逻辑错误:逻辑错误是指代码在处理过程中的错误逻辑导致程序不能按照预期的方式运行。例如,一个算法的实现不正确,导致程序无法正确处理输入数据。逻辑错误通常是比较难以发现和修复的,需要开发者仔细检查代码逻辑并进行调试。
-
硬件或环境问题:有时程序无法运行是由于硬件设备或操作系统环境的问题引起的。例如,某些程序可能需要特定的硬件设备才能运行,或者需要在特定的操作系统版本上才能正常工作。如果缺少必要的硬件或环境支持,程序就无法运行。
-
配置问题:有时程序无法运行是由于配置问题引起的。例如,程序可能需要访问数据库或网络服务,但是没有正确设置连接参数或权限,导致程序无法访问所需的资源。
对于这些问题,开发者可以采取一些方法来解决:
-
检查错误信息:当编译错误或运行时错误发生时,应该仔细阅读错误信息,找出错误的原因和位置。错误信息通常提供了有用的线索,有助于定位问题。
-
调试代码:开发者可以使用调试工具来逐步执行代码,检查每一步的结果,以找出错误的原因。调试工具可以提供变量的值、代码的执行路径等信息,帮助开发者理解代码的行为。
-
仔细检查代码逻辑:开发者应该仔细检查代码逻辑,确保代码能够正确地处理各种情况。可以通过代码复审或者一些静态代码分析工具来帮助发现潜在的逻辑错误。
-
测试环境和配置:开发者应该确保程序运行的环境和配置是正确的。可以尝试在不同的环境和配置下运行程序,以确定问题是由特定的环境或配置引起的。
总之,编程后不能用的原因有很多,开发者需要仔细检查代码、调试并解决问题,确保程序能够正确运行。
1年前 -